探索经典开发工具,VS2005中文版的全面解析与实用指南
引言:为什么VS2005中文版至今仍值得关注?
在软件开发的历史长河中,Visual Studio 2005(简称VS2005)无疑是一款具有里程碑意义的集成开发环境(IDE),尽管如今我们已经进入了Visual Studio 2022的时代,但VS2005中文版作为一款经典的开发工具,依然在许多场景中发挥着重要作用,无论是学习编程基础、维护老旧系统,还是研究.NET框架的早期版本,VS2005都提供了不可替代的价值。
本文将围绕VS2005中文版展开深入探讨,帮助读者了解它的功能特点、安装使用方法以及如何应对常见问题,通过生动的实例和实用建议,我们将为开发者提供一份全面且易懂的指南。
VS2005中文版的核心亮点
-
支持.NET Framework 2.0 VS2005是微软首次全面支持.NET Framework 2.0的IDE,这标志着一个全新的开发时代的到来。.NET Framework 2.0引入了泛型(Generics)、匿名方法(Anonymous Methods)等重要特性,极大地提升了代码的复用性和可读性,以下代码展示了泛型集合的简单应用:
List<int> numbers = new List<int>(); numbers.Add(1); numbers.Add(2); foreach (int number in numbers) { Console.WriteLine(number); }这段代码不仅简洁,而且避免了类型转换的麻烦,体现了.NET 2.0的强大之处。
-
多语言支持 VS2005中文版内置对C#、VB.NET、C++等多种编程语言的支持,开发者可以根据需求灵活选择,中文界面降低了语言障碍,使得国内开发者更容易上手。
-
强大的调试功能 VS2005提供了直观的调试工具,包括断点设置、变量监视和调用堆栈分析等功能,这些工具可以帮助开发者快速定位并修复代码中的错误,提高开发效率。
-
Windows Forms与ASP.NET开发 在桌面应用开发方面,VS2005的Windows Forms设计器非常友好;而在Web开发领域,它对ASP.NET的支持也相当完善,无论是构建企业级管理系统还是简单的个人网站,VS2005都能胜任。

如何安装与配置VS2005中文版?
-
下载安装包 确保从可靠的来源获取VS2005中文版的安装文件,由于该版本年代久远,建议优先考虑官方渠道或信誉良好的第三方资源。
-
系统要求 安装前需要确认计算机是否满足最低硬件要求:
- 操作系统:Windows XP SP2及以上
- 内存:至少512MB(推荐1GB以上)
- 硬盘空间:至少2GB可用空间
-
安装步骤
- 双击安装文件,启动安装向导。
- 根据提示选择安装路径和组件(如C#开发工具、Web开发工具等)。
- 等待安装完成,并重启计算机以生效。
-
激活与更新 如果安装的是试用版,请务必及时输入产品密钥进行激活,考虑到VS2005的安全补丁已停止更新,建议仅在受控环境中使用,避免潜在风险。
VS2005中文版的实际应用场景
-
教学与学习 对于初学者而言,VS2005中文版是一款极佳的学习工具,其相对简单的界面和丰富的文档资源,能够让新手快速掌握编程基础知识,在讲解面向对象编程时,可以利用VS2005创建一个简单的“学生管理系统”,演示类、对象、继承等概念。
-
遗留系统的维护 许多企业仍在运行基于.NET 2.0的应用程序,因此VS2005成为维护这些系统的必备工具,某制造业公司可能有一套使用VS2005开发的库存管理系统,工程师可以通过VS2005轻松修改业务逻辑或优化性能。
-
嵌入式开发 尽管VS2005并非专门针对嵌入式开发设计,但它仍然可以用于一些小型项目的开发工作,某些工业控制设备的固件程序可能依赖于.NET Micro Framework,而VS2005正是支持这一框架的少数IDE之一。
常见问题及解决方案
-
兼容性问题 在现代操作系统(如Windows 10/11)上运行VS2005时,可能会遇到兼容性问题,解决办法是在安装目录下右键点击
devenv.exe,选择“属性” -> “兼容性”,勾选“以兼容模式运行这个程序”,并选择Windows XP SP3。 -
缺少必要的服务包 如果安装完成后发现部分功能无法正常使用,可能是缺少Service Pack 1(SP1),可以从微软官网下载并安装SP1补丁。
-
性能优化 为了提升VS2005的运行速度,可以关闭不必要的插件和服务,进入“工具” -> “选项” -> “环境” -> “加载项/宏”,禁用不常用的扩展。
总结与展望
尽管VS2005中文版已不再是最前沿的开发工具,但它的历史地位和技术价值不容忽视,对于希望深入了解.NET生态系统、学习传统开发技术或者处理遗留项目的人来说,这款IDE依然是一个不错的选择。
我们也必须认识到,随着技术的不断进步,新的开发工具和框架层出不穷,如果您正在寻找更高效、更安全的开发环境,不妨尝试升级到最新版本的Visual Studio,建议结合实际需求制定合理的迁移计划,逐步淘汰过时的技术栈。
无论您是资深开发者还是刚刚入门的新手,都可以从VS2005中文版中汲取宝贵的经验,希望本文能为您打开一扇通往经典开发世界的大门,同时也激励您继续探索更多先进的技术和工具!
相关文章
-
免费代理IP地址的使用指南与风险解析详细阅读
在当今互联网高速发展的时代,网络隐私和数据安全成为了人们关注的焦点,无论是日常浏览网页、访问受限内容,还是进行商业数据分析,代理IP地址都扮演着重要的...
2026-05-30 19
-
CPU—电脑的大脑,如何让我们的数字生活更智能?详细阅读
在现代科技的世界里,CPU(中央处理器)是计算机的核心部件,堪称一台设备的“大脑”,它不仅决定了你的电脑运行速度有多快,还直接影响了你玩游戏、看电影、...
2026-05-30 18
-
VRP问题解析,从理论到实际应用,如何优化物流与路径规划?详细阅读
在现代物流、交通运输和供应链管理中,路径规划是一个核心问题,而“车辆路径问题”(Vehicle Routing Problem,简称VRP)作为其中的...
2026-05-30 22
-
阿里云小程序,开启数字化生活的轻量级钥匙详细阅读
在当今这个数字化飞速发展的时代,手机已经成为我们日常生活中不可或缺的一部分,而小程序作为一种轻量级的应用形式,正在悄然改变着我们的生活方式,无论是点外...
2026-05-30 22
-
华为三层交换机,企业网络的智慧大脑,让数据流动更高效!详细阅读
在当今数字化时代,企业和组织的网络就像一座繁忙的城市,每台设备、每个用户都像是城市中的居民和车辆,而数据则是道路上川流不息的车流,如果交通没有良好的管...
2026-05-30 21
-
文件名的命名规则,让数字世界井井有条的小秘密详细阅读
你有没有过这样的经历?打开电脑,想找到某个重要的文件,却发现桌面上乱七八糟地堆满了各种名字奇怪的文档,新建文本文档 (2 .txt”、“会议记录1.d...
2026-05-30 17
- 详细阅读
-
无限的未知2003,探索未来的起点与无限可能详细阅读
引言:从“无限”到“未知”,一个充满希望的旅程“无限的未知2003”——这短短几个字,听起来像是科幻小说里的章节标题,又仿佛是对人类未来的一种隐喻,它...
2026-05-30 20
